Several studies have reported on the control of S. mutans using peptides. This study does not provide a direct comparison of AVHS with other known antimicrobial peptides or detected minor peptides. This is a serious limitation that makes it difficult to assess the relative efficacy and uniqueness of AVHS.
Although this study highlights the plaque-derived nature of AVHS and its potential oral environmental affinity, it does not provide experimental data to quantify this adaptability or compare it with other peptides.
This study did not examine the potential of the addition of RWWRWW to affect the environmental adaptability or oral affinity of AVHS. This is an important and unexplored aspect. The potential trade-off between the increased antimicrobial activity and environmental adaptability of the modified peptides should be clarified.
The fact that AVHS is the "predominant metabolite" in children without dental caries is an important finding; however, there seems to be a lack of consideration as to why this peptide is predominant in children without dental caries.
- Are AVHS produced by specific beneficial bacteria in the oral microbiome?
- Does AVHS play a role in maintaining oral microbiome balance?
- Is the presence of an AVHS a consequence of or a contributor to the caries-free state?
- Are genetic or environmental factors that may influence AVHS production?
This is indeed an important aspect that needs to be analyzed in more detail in the future. This could provide valuable insights into the mechanisms of caries prevention and lead to the development of targeted preventive strategies.
In this study, because a lot of time is needed to conduct new experiments, it is sufficient to enrich the discussion.
